随着年龄的增长,人类大脑网络的认知虚构状态发生变化:认知整合和分离的变化

概括
衰老的大脑显示出大脑区域同步的动态灵活性, 嵌合体状态对于平衡认知整合和分离至关重要. 这种灵活性可能反映出对认知衰退的补偿机制,尽管衰老对认知系统的影响不同.
科学领域:
- 神经科学
- 认知科学
- 计算生物学
背景情况:
- 大脑衰老涉及结构和功能变化,但这些变化如何通过大脑活动模式影响认知能力尚不清楚.
- 认知能力依赖于大脑整合与分离之间的动态切换.
- 代表部分同步的奇默状态被提议用于捕捉这种动态灵活性.
研究的目的:
- 研究认知整合和隔离之间与年龄相关的动态灵活性.
- 探索神经认知衰老中的幻象状态的作用.
- 了解衰老如何对各种认知系统产生不同影响.
主要方法:
- 使用基于同步的框架和认知型模型.
- 分析了健康群体的大规模,多站点的横截面数据集.
- 研究了与年龄相关的虚构状态和同步模式的变化.
主要成果:
- 在衰老过程中保持认知融合与分离之间的平衡至关重要.
- 衰老会对不同的认知系统产生独特的影响,并观察到不同的同步趋势.
- 在老年人群中,动态灵活性通常会增加,这可能表明补偿机制或脱差.
结论:
- 提供了关于认知衰退和衰老保护机制的新见解.
- 了解特定系统的衰老模式对于全面了解神经认知衰老至关重要.
- 不同的认知系统在衰老过程中可以同时存在分化和分化.
